The differences between hotel reservation agents and reservations agents can be seen in a few details. Each job has different responsibilities and duties. Additionally, a hotel reservation agent has an average salary of $33,694, which is higher than the $31,591 average annual salary of a reservations agent.
The top three skills for a hotel reservation agent include reservations, hotel reservations and booking. The most important skills for a reservations agent are reservations, customer service, and booking.
